Thomas W. Powell

This paper describes a 64-item clinical screening task designed to assess the accuracy of children's consonant cluster productions. This procedure is designed to help speech-language pathologists develop intervention programs to improve children's production of clusters by facilitating the identification of error patterns. Once such patterns have been identified, individualized treatment programs designed to maximize generalization may be developed. The task was administered to 100 4- and 5-year-old subjects to assess the technical adequacy of the procedure. Internal consistency reliability of the task was high, and the procedure was also shown to assess an appropriately diverse array of word-initial and word-final consonant clusters. Finally, the construct validity of the task was supported by factor analytic procedures.

DMITRY IDIATOV

L2 speakers of Nigerian English in parts of northeastern Nigeria occasionally insert an alveolar coronal stop [t] or fricative [s] following another alveolar coronal pre-pausally and phrase-internally. The article discusses this typologically unusual phenomenon for the Nigerian English of speakers whose L1 is the Adamawa language Bena (ISO 639-3: yun). I also consider comparable cases of word-final consonant epenthesis in several other varieties of English, both the so-called New Englishes and Inner Circle varieties, and provide an account of the details of epenthesis with respect to which they differ. At first sight, hypercorrection of the tendency for word-final consonant cluster simplification in Bena English may seem an obvious explanation. However, I argue that hypercorrection alone falls short of explaining the observed pattern. In addition, we need to call on phonetic properties of Bena L1 such as pre-pausal glottalisation and lengthening of consonants to be able to account for both the actuation of the hypercorrection and the phonologisation of the epenthesis. Although the availability of a clear phonetic explanation makes this sound pattern conceivable as a natural rule, its typological rarity in non-contact lects highlights the positive bias induced by hypercorrection as a necessary part of the mix in creating the conditions for a reanalysis.

Michela Russo ◽  
Shanti Ulfsbjorninn

Autosegmentalism invariably represents geminates in a symmetrical one-to-many relationship — as feature bundles or root nodes attached to two structural units: x-slots, moras, or C-slots. This symmetry, however, is often not reflected in their diachronic origin. For instance, in Blevins’ (2008) Type 1 pathway, only the second C of a consonant cluster (CC) ever determines the geminate: CxCy > CyCy, *CxCx (e.g. Latin > Italian). Moreover, although most synchronic processes identify geminates as symmetrical, there is an exception: geminate integrity. Unlike CCs and long vowels (LVs), geminates never ‘break’ by epenthesis: *CyCy > CyVCy. We propose that this is central to understanding the true nature of geminates, and present analyses in two frameworks. The first is ‘control by contiguity’, which uses head-dependent ‘control chains’ (Russo 2013). A control relation applies between a specified and an unspecified position: -C. Inalterability and integrity result from the asymmetry of the geminate’s positions. The second is based on Strict CV. This restricts a geminate’s melody to one of its two skeletal positions. Unlike CC and LVs, geminates do not involve a ‘trapped’ empty V position that could host epenthesis and cause breaking; the difference between LVs and geminates follows from framework-internal forces and suggests that melodic branching always requires licensing. These two approaches share the insight that the representation of geminates is not symmetrical, like that of long vowels.

Eman M. Al-Yami ◽  
Anwar A. H. Al-Athwary

This study investigates the pronunciation difficulty of selected English consonant clusters (CCs) encountered by Saudi EFL learners. The sample consisted of 134 female Saudi EFL students in their freshman year in the English Department at Najran University. Two instruments were used: a pronunciation test that assessed participants’ CC pronunciations in the onset and coda positions and a questionnaire that explored participants’ attitudes towards their CC pronunciations. This study provides detailed data on the participants’ pronunciation difficulties using Optimality Theory (OT). The results showed that the participants encountered CC pronunciation difficulties in both the onset and coda positions. However, most errors occurred in the coda position, especially for the four-consonant pattern (-CCCC). Participants used different strategies to simplify their CC pronunciations: epenthesis, deletion, substitution, or some combination thereof. Questionnaire data indicated that the participants attributed their pronunciation difficulties to inadequate knowledge of the pronunciation rules, insufficient language instruction, and native-language influence. The participants proffered some remedies to their difficulties, which included doing more pronunciation drills and offering a new course focused primarily on correct pronunciation. OT analysis revealed that onset clusters were mainly influenced by L1 ranking constraints whereas coda clusters were more influenced by universal Markedness constraints. OT indicated that the tendency to satisfy Markedness constraints over the Faithfulness constraints led the participants to use the above-mentioned simplification strategies.

Thora Másdóttir ◽  
Sharynne McLeod ◽  
Kathryn Crowe

Purpose This study investigated Icelandic-speaking children's acquisition of singleton consonants and consonant clusters. Method Participants were 437 typically developing children aged 2;6–7;11 (years;months) acquiring Icelandic as their first language. Single-word speech samples of the 47 single consonants and 45 consonant clusters were collected using Málhljóðapróf ÞM (ÞM's Test of Speech Sound Disorders). Results Percentage of consonants correct for children aged 2;6–2;11 was 73.12 ( SD = 13.33) and increased to 98.55 ( SD = 3.24) for children aged 7;0–7;11. Overall, singleton consonants were more likely to be accurate than consonant clusters. The earliest consonants to be acquired were /m, n, p, t, j, h/ in word-initial position and /f, l/ within words. The last consonants to be acquired were /x, r, r̥, s, θ, n̥/, and consonant clusters in word-initial /sv-, stl-, str-, skr-, θr-/, within-word /-ðr-, -tl-/, and word-final /-kl̥, -xt/ contexts. Within-word phonemes were more often accurate than those in word-initial position, with word-final position the least accurate. Accuracy of production was significantly related to increasing age, but not sex. Conclusions This is the first comprehensive study of consonants and consonant cluster acquisition by typically developing Icelandic-speaking children. The findings align with trends for other Germanic languages; however, there are notable language-specific differences of clinical importance.

Wenckje Jongstra

AbstractThis article reports on between-individual and within-individual variation in consonant cluster reduction strategies (where C1C2 is realised as C( or C2) among young children. The empirical base of the study is a Dutch database with over 9,000 instances of C1 and C2 realisations of 23 word-initial consonant clusters from 45 children aged between two and three years old. The study finds that within-child variation is very limited, whereas between-child variation occurs. It is also shown that there are typological implications; that is, realising C2 in cluster y, implies realising C2 in cluster y, but not vice versa. The data provide support for the position that variation can be accounted for by a finer grained notion of sonority where the sonority distance between the two consonants in a cluster plays a crucial role in establishing prosodic constituency.
